Several sites were First Come, First Served. I arrived at almost dark; which sites might be reserved? Route 64 traffic 100' from my tent didn't keep me awake. Swimming beach was downhill a little ways on the other side. The lake lies at the end of the paved access loop -- great view! Sites have gravel on level parking, trees, wood fencing.

We were on site N102 with a 32' trailer. Plenty of room and nicely shaded. This site is near the bath and shower houses. Not a great view of the water. Gravel but very level.

Beautiful Corps of Engineers campground on Pamme de Terra Lake. Site 49 was on the lake and felt more private. Some campsites have bridge road noise. The handicapped toilet/shower bathrooms at one end of camp floood floor easily when shower is on. Boat ramp and paths down to water along with a swimming beach and ample fishing opportunities make this a great stop.
